Academic Year Plan Policy

Harmonic Academy of Music – Burlington, Ontario. This document outlines the complete terms and conditions for students enrolled in the Academic Year Plan. Enrollment confirms agreement with all policies listed below.

1. Program Overview

The Academic Year Plan is designed for students seeking consistent, structured musical development. It follows the local school calendar and includes:

  • Term 1: September – December (12 weekly lessons)
  • Term 2: January – March (12 weekly lessons)​
  • Term 3: April – June (12 weekly lessons)

Total: 36 lessons per academic year. Students may enroll at any time. Tuition for partial terms is prorated based on the remaining lessons.

3. Tuition & Payment Options

Tuition is payable per term or for the full academic year. Tuition covers reserved lesson time, not attendance.

Discounts for prepayment:

  • 2 terms upfront (24 lessons): 4% discount
  • Full year upfront (36 lessons): 8% discount and registration fee waived
  • Family Discount: 10% per additional family member

4. Lesson Rescheduling

  • Minimum 48 hours’ notice required for rescheduling.
  • Up to 3 rescheduled lessons per term permitted.
  • Rescheduled lessons are issued as Make-Up Credits.
  • Missed lessons beyond the allowed number are considered absences.

5. Make-Up Credit Policy

  • Credits expire at the end of the term in which they were issued.
  • Credits cannot be scheduled during the student’s regular lesson time.
  • Scheduling must be coordinated with the Admin Team.
  • Credits cannot be converted to cash or applied toward future tuition.

6. Absences

Lessons missed without proper notice or beyond the allowed reschedules are considered absences. Absences are not eligible for make-up.

7. Instructor Cancellations

If an instructor cancels a lesson, it will be rescheduled or issued as a Make-Up Credit.

9. Withdrawal & Refund Policy

  • Students who withdraw receive a 50% refund of remaining prepaid lessons.
  • Registration fees are non-refundable.
  • Refunds are issued to the original payment method within 5–7 business days.
